Countdown Recap 27 March 1991
Series 21, First Semi Final
Dictionary: Concise Oxford Dictionary

C1: Jackie McLeod, from Highgate North London. Local Government Secretary. Number 8 seed. won 3 games scoring 187 points. Knocked out the then unbeaten no 1 seed Lew Schwarz, 55 - 33. Average 48.4.


C2: Nick Saloman, a musician from East London. won 4 games before losing to Barry Grossman in the preliminaries. Barry will be in tomorrows semi final. Nick is number 3 seed. Scored 270 points and averaged 48 points. Knocked out John Arfon in the quarter finals.

DC: Brian Johnston and Richard Samson
RW: Richard Whiteley
CV: Carol Voderman

Round 1: B G T I U R L O W
C1: rigout (x)
C2: outrig (x)
DC: GROWL (5)
Score 00 - 00

Both contestants not happy with the outcome and voice their disapproval. RW reminds them to leave it behind and carry on.

Round 2: L R C M I E G A C
C1: MIRACLE (7)
C2: MIRACLE (7)
DC: RECALIM, GLACIER (7)
Score 07 - 07

Round 3: F W S X I A D I S
C1: WAIFS (5)
C2: WADIS (5)
DC: -
Score 12 - 12

Round 4: 198 (50 1 3 1 5 10)
C1: 198 (10) same way as C2

C2: 198 (10) 4 + 1 = 4. 4 x 50 = 200. 10 / 5 = 2. 200 - 2 = 198

Score 22 - 22


Round 5: B K N S E A P G Y
C1: SPANK (5)
C2: BANKS (5)
DC: SPEAK, PANSY (5), SNEAKY (6)
Score 27 - 27

Round 6: S S D O E M T U P
C1: STUMPED (7)
C2: stouped (x)
DC: STOMPED (7)
Score 34 - 27

Round 7: L D Y T O J E A D
C1: JOLTED (6)
C2: dolated (x)
DC: TOADY (5), DEADLY (6)
Score 40 - 27

Round 8: 964 (50 3 1 9 2 1)
C1: 0 (0)
C2: 964 (0) 2 x 9 = 18. 18 + 1 = 19. 19 + (50 + 1) = 967. 967 - 3 = 964.
Hold on 19 x 51 is 969.
CV: 964 (10) 50 + 3 = 53. 53 x 2 = 106. 106 + 1 = 107. 107 x 9 = 963. 963 + 1 = 964.
Score 40 - 27

Round 9 (Conundrum): S T I C K H O L M

C1 buzzes in after 15 seconds and correctly says LOCKSMITH.

Score 50 - 27

NS recieved a countdown pen for his troubles!

RW tells the audience of NS's new record from Recklees Records, New River Head.

RW introduces tomorrow's semi final contestants: Gillian Tickle and Barry Grossman.
(This is a rematch from the prelimins!!)
